Some of the most common causes of nursing home abuse in Palm Beach Gardens include:
- Untrained Staff: When caregivers are inexperienced or negligent, it can lead to poor care, causing serious harm to residents.
- Lack of Staff Supervision: Inadequate supervision of staff can result in abuse and neglect going unnoticed.
- Understaffing: When facilities are understaffed, employees may be unable to provide proper care and attention to residents.
- Theft of Belongings: Some staff members may exploit residents’ vulnerability by stealing their personal belongings.
- Lack of Protocols and Safety Standards: Poor facility conditions and lack of adherence to safety protocols put residents in unsafe and vulnerable situations.
- Isolation: Residents who are isolated or lack visitors may be at a higher risk for abuse.
- Medical Malpractice: Failure to properly attend to medical needs can exacerbate health issues or result in new illnesses. Health care fraud is also a concern that can often be addressed with quick action.

Emergency Signs of Nursing Home Abuse
It’s important to be aware of potential signs of abuse and neglect. Early detection is key to protecting your loved one from further harm. While some signs may be subtle, any red flags should be investigated immediately.
There are both internal and external signs that may indicate abuse. Some may not be immediately visible but can still be sensed through changes in behavior or demeanor. If you notice any signs, it’s essential to act quickly to protect your family member’s well-being.
Here are some signs to look out for:
- Physical Injuries: Cuts, bruises, fractures, sprains, weight loss, bed sores, and ulcers.
- Staff Misbehavior: Verbal abuse, intimidation, threats, humiliation, or causing confusion and panic among residents.
- Changes in Resident Behavior: Increased aggression, sadness, withdrawal, or unusual behaviors not seen before.
- Refusal of Medical Care: Failure to provide necessary medical care in response to an emergency or neglect of health needs.

Situations Where Nursing Homes May Be Liable
When nursing homes fail to provide proper care, they can be held legally accountable. A Palm Beach Gardens Nursing Home Abuse Attorney will investigate the circumstances and determine liability for the abuse, neglect, or misconduct.
These situations can include:
- Physical, Emotional, and Psychological Mistreatment: Poor hygiene, neglect, abandonment, inadequate nutrition, and lack of hydration.
- Intimidation and Exploitation: Abusive actions that cause emotional damage, anxiety, stress, depression, and other psychological harm.
- Sexual Abuse: Abuse perpetrated by either staff members or other residents.
- Poor Facility Maintenance: Lack of safety standards or dangerous living conditions that put residents at risk.
- Medical Malpractice: Errors in diagnosis, treatments, or medication administration, leading to further harm to the resident.
